I'm creating my own DataGrid using AS and am not sure how to
access the "name" of the returned XML via e4x to be used by the
dataField property of my DataGridColumn. Below is the xml I would
like displayed:

  • Flash Access DRM FMP Fails When Authentication Dialog Triggered for Display

    Hi all,
    Flash Media Playback is failing in the case when playing a video that has Flash Access DRM that requires display of an authentication dialog.  A sample failing configuration is here:
    http://provenwebvideo.com/codesamples/10/fmp_drm/ 
    Note, the link above includes the same video asset running successfully in Strobe Media Playback 1.0 (alongside to the right).
    Also, the link above includes FMP working successfully with a second video that has Flash Access DRM but which does NOT trigger display of an authentication dialog (second video in player in a row below the failing player).
    Source on the Flash Access DRM video test assets are from the Flash Access team via the following link:
    http://forums.adobe.com/message/3144143#3144143
    fyi, This is not a showstopper for me.  I am just reporting it as I was surprised that it works with SMP, but fails with current FMP.
    hth,
    g

    Wow, Greg, the test page is awesome! I can only wish that all the issues get reported this way!
    The issue with DRM content played with http://fpdownload.adobe.com/strobe/FlashMediaPlayback.swf is caused by the fact that the FlashMediaPlayback.swf is compiled for the Flash Player 10.0.
    I tested your sample with the Flash Media Playback compiled for 10.1 (http://fpdownload.adobe.com/strobe/FlashMediaPlayback_101.swf) and it works fine: http://smpfmp.appspot.com/fmp_drm.html
    Note that you need to ask your viewers to upgrade to the latest flash player, since Flash Media Playback doesn't handle this automatically, yet. (we have this feature in the backlog, but it might not fit into our future 1.5 release). Check this for technical details related to this: http://www.adobe.com/devnet/flashplayer/articles/swfobject.html
    Does this information help? Is there something that you would expect us to implement or document better?

  • In VB Programming code -- How to access the formula for suppressing a field

    In VB Programming code -- How to access the formula for suppressing a field
    I am using Crystal Reports 2008 v1
    Using VB code, I am attempting to modify a Crystal Report before exporting it into a PDF format and then displaying it on the Web.
    My problem is that I am unable to access the formula used to dynamically suppress a field.
    The following code is working:
    mySections = rd.ReportDefinition.Sections
    For Each mySection As CrystalDecisions.CrystalReports.Engine.Section In mySections
       ' myFieldToChange is a String set to the text of the field I need to adjust the Suppression
       iloop = 0
       For Each RecObj As CrystalDecisions.CrystalReports.Engine.ReportObject In mySection.ReportObjects
               If mySection.ReportObjects.Item(iloop).Name.ToLower = myFieldToChange Then
                   myTextObject = CType(mySection.ReportObjects.Item(iloop), CrystalDecisions.CrystalReports.Engine.TextObject)
                   myTextObject.Text = "new field text goes here"
                   mySection.SectionFormat.EnableSuppress = True
                   '  Here is where I want to change the formula for the Suppression
                End if
                iloop = iloop + 1
        Next
    Next
    I can not find any reference to the actual suppression formula in the SDK help file.
    Note, the EnableSuppress can be set to True for False, but if there is a formula for dynamic suppression, the True or False value is overwritten.  The results of the formula determine the suppression.
    Is there a way to reference this formula.  I know that I can put on in using the Crystal Report Designer software, I need to modify this formula using VB code and the SDK.

    Hello, Mark;
    If you are using the ReportDocument object you do not have access to the Conditional Suppression formula. You can get around it by using a formula field in the report for the supression and then using the FormulaField code to change it at runtime.
    If you want to change the supression condition directly at runtime you need to use RAS and the ReportClientDocument.
    Elaine

  • Error while accessing Heirarchy node in report

    Hi Experts,
    I am getting an error message while accessing a node in hierarchy while using variables for reports. I used Tcode RSZV but its throwing error that it doesnot exist in BW 3.x and it is embedded in Bex. Can any one guide me for any other options available to get the same functionality in Bex?
    Thanks ,
    Pilli.

    Hi Pilligay,
    First check the version you are using.
    T code RSZV is used in the earlier version of 3.0B only.
    From 3.0B onwards it is possible in the query designer (BEx) itself. You need to  right click on the info object for which you want to use as a variable and proceed further in selecting variable type and processing type.
